Mushroom vegetables with peppers and bacon

Spread the love

Ingredients for 2 servings:

  • 100 g mushrooms, brown
  • 100 g chanterelles
  • 15 g porcini mushrooms, dried
  • n. B. Water for soaking
  • 1 red bell pepper(s)
  • 1 onion(s), diced
  • 75 g ham, diced
  • 1 tbsp rosemary
  • 1 tbsp thyme
  • 1 tbsp oregano
  • salt and pepper
  • e.g. olive oil

Instructions

Working time approx. 10 minutes; Rest time approx. 3 hours; Total time approx. 3 hours 10 minutes

Wash the dried porcini mushrooms and soak them for a few hours. Clean the mushrooms and quarter them if necessary (depending on their size). Wash the bell peppers and cut them into small cubes. Brown the diced ham in a little olive oil, add the diced onion and sauté until translucent. Add the chopped rosemary needles. Once everything is nicely sautéed, add the drained porcini mushrooms. After two to three minutes, add the mushrooms and bell peppers to the pan. When the vegetables and mushrooms are cooked, season with salt and pepper and add the herbs. Tastes great with briefly pan-fried meat.
